Premises Liability

Premises liability covers cases where property owners fail to maintain safe environments, leading to injuries or preventable crimes.

Common Slip-and-Fall Hazards

Slip-and-fall accidents often result from hazards like wet floors, uneven surfaces, poor lighting, or cluttered walkways. Identifying these risks is crucial for preventing injuries and pursuing legal claims.

Legal Duty of Property Owners

Property owners have a legal duty to maintain safe conditions for visitors. Failing to address hazards can make them liable for injuries, highlighting the importance of understanding property liability laws.

Injuries on Private Property vs. Public Property

Injuries can occur on both private and public property, but the legal rules for liability often differ. Understanding who is responsible and the types of claims available is essential for protecting your rights.

What Is Negligent Security?

Negligent security occurs when property owners fail to provide reasonable safety measures, leading to preventable injuries or crimes. Understanding this legal concept is key for victims seeking compensation.
